CeeDee Lamb vs. Terry McLaurin: A Battle for Receiver Supremacy

2026-06-11 · CeeDee Lamb · Rivalry

There’s nothing quite like the anticipation of a heavyweight showdown in the NFL, and when CeeDee Lamb meets Terry McLaurin, fans have learned to expect fireworks. Every snap is charged with energy, a pulsating rhythm that echoes the competitive spirit of both athletes. While they represent different franchises-Lamb with the storied Dallas Cowboys and McLaurin with the Washington Commanders-their connection is undeniable. It’s a rivalry punctuated by respect, skill, and a relentless pursuit of excellence.

Take a moment to picture it: the noise of a packed stadium, fans clad in team colors, the smell of popcorn and hope in the air. As the game clock winds down, all eyes fixate on Lamb and McLaurin, each poised to make a statement. The contrast in their styles is intriguing. CeeDee, with his smooth route-running and elusive agility, often leaves defenders grasping at air. He’s a maestro on the field, orchestrating plays with a graceful touch. McLaurin, on the other hand, embodies toughness. He fights for every yard, showing a knack for high-pointing the ball like it’s a personal challenge.

Their rivalry took root in the NFC East, a division known for its ferocity. Each game becomes a battleground, where stats and highlights are crafted, but also narratives are shaped. Lamb’s ability to stretch the field combines seamlessly with the downfield prowess of McLaurin, creating an offensive chess match that fans can’t help but relish. Whether it's a well-placed deep ball or a crucial third-down conversion, these two receivers can turn the tide of a game in the blink of an eye.

Consider the 2022 season, where expectations hung over both of them like a cloud. Lamb was the go-to option for Dak Prescott, becoming the focal point of a revamped Cowboys offense. McLaurin, meanwhile, was tasked with bringing consistency to a Commanders team that had seen its share of struggles. The battles between them became narratives that fueled their teams, launching moments of brilliance into the spotlight. With each contested catch and touchdown dance, they seemed to raise the bar for one another.

Beyond the numbers, there’s a personal edge to this rivalry, a subtext that adds layers to their matchups. Both players have faced their own sets of challenges, from injuries to quarterback changes, but they’ve responded with tenacity. Lamb often speaks about the respect he has for McLaurin, citing his work ethic and relentless spirit. McLaurin, in turn, acknowledges Lamb’s skill and the role he plays in elevating the game. It’s not just a competitive rivalry; it’s also a brotherhood forged in the fires of competition.

As we gear up for another season of clashes between the Cowboys and Commanders, the CeeDee Lamb vs. Terry McLaurin saga is bound to captivate fans and analysts alike. Watching them go head-to-head, it's not only about who walks away with the win; it's about how they push each other to new heights. This rivalry has the makings of a classic, and for fans, each game only deepens the appreciation for what these two wide receivers bring to the table.
